81 Columbia March 5th 1894 The Town council met pursuant to adjournment Mayor Hutchinson presiding Roll call and the following council men present - Willacy, McKay & Groat The minutes of the last meeting read and on motion approved. The committee appointed to audite the books of the Clerk and Treasurer report and on motion the report accepted The report of the water committee on the work done under Joseph Hellenthal on the water works for month of January read and approved and on motion warrants ordered drawnfor the payment of the work done in excess of the water rent and the Treasurers instructed to credit the amount worked out on water rent to the several accounts and to give receipts for the same. Bill from Z C Miles read and on motion laid on the table. Bill from O S Hepler for laying pipes on Angelina St $51.73 read and on motion ordered paid. The report of the City Engineer read and on motion ordered placed on file. Motion made and carried to lay the matter of grading Angelina St on the table until the next meeting. Attorney Peterson's report on the ownership of the Park and on motion it was decided to postpone the park question unitl next meeting. Ordinance #44 known as the dog tax ordinance read and on motion passed by the council and approved by the Mayor. Ordinance # 45 referring to applying of Columbia St improvement warrants as payment of assessment against property fronting on that street read and on motion laid on the table until next meeting.
